Iconic Movie Jackets Through the Decades

Some movie jackets have transcended the screen to become symbols of their time. One of the most iconic examples is Indiana Jones' leather jacket. Worn by Harrison Ford, this rugged, weathered jacket became synonymous with adventure and heroism. It perfectly complemented the character's fearless, yet down-to-earth persona. Similarly, Top Gun's bomber jacket, sported by Tom Cruise's character, Maverick, has remained a fashion statement for decades, influencing men's fashion by making aviator jackets and bomber styles perennial wardrobe staples.

The Matrix trilogy brought another iconic piece to life with Neo's long black trench coat. This jacket epitomized the slick, futuristic vibe of the series and set the tone for an era of fashion that blended the dystopian with the modern. The trench coat became a symbol of rebellion and otherworldly coolness, and its impact on fashion is still seen in contemporary streetwear.

A Christmas Story: Nostalgia and Warmth in Every Stitch

When it comes to holiday movies, A Christmas Story Outfits is a timeless classic that brings to life the cozy, wintery essence of Christmas. The film, set in the 1940s, captures the charm of the era, and the outfits worn by the characters are part of what makes it so iconic. Perhaps the most memorable jacket from the movie is Ralphie's brother Randy's massive snowsuit, which is more of a cocoon than an outfit. Randy's inability to lower his arms while bundled in layers of winter clothing has become an enduring symbol of the holiday season.

Though it's more of a winter ensemble than a classic jacket, Randy's snowsuit has captured the essence of childhood winter experiences. It's the kind of practical, over-the-top winter gear that parents everywhere recognize. The film's wardrobe, including this now-iconic outerwear, provides a sense of nostalgia for simpler times when bundling up in a too-big coat was all part of the holiday fun.

Then there's Ralphie's double-breasted winter coat, which adds a more subtle fashion statement compared to his brother's outfit. This practical and stylish coat is both functional for the bitter winter temperatures and true to the fashion of the time. The layers, hats, and scarves in A Christmas Story all evoke a sense of holiday warmth, where jackets are not just fashion pieces but necessities to brave the cold winter months.

Falling for Christmas: Cozy Chic Holiday Wardrobe

While A Christmas Story focuses on the nostalgia of childhood winters, Falling for Christmas Outfits is a modern holiday rom-com that brings forth a different aesthetic altogether. Released in 2022, this film stars Lindsay Lohan and offers a cozy yet chic take on winter fashion. The movie captures the spirit of Christmas, not only through its heartwarming story but also through its wardrobe. Lohan's character, Sierra, is often seen in luxurious coats, fur-lined jackets, and soft knits that elevate her style while keeping her snug in the frosty winter setting.

One standout jacket from Falling for Christmas is Sierra's stunning white fur-trimmed coat. This piece is the epitome of holiday elegance, combining luxury with the necessity of staying warm in a snowy wonderland. The jacket, with its pristine white color and plush trim, feels both festive and timeless. It's a look that instantly conjures up images of glamorous winter getaways and holiday parties. Unlike the nostalgic, more rugged styles seen in A Christmas Story, the wardrobe in Falling for Christmas is all about indulgence, luxury, and a modern approach to holiday fashion.

Another noteworthy piece is the colorful knit sweaters that both Sierra and other characters wear throughout the film. These chunky sweaters, often paired with oversized coats, blend practicality with style, making them perfect for both cozy nights by the fire and strolls through a winter wonderland. The movie taps into contemporary winter fashion trends, focusing on warm, layered looks that feel as inviting as they are stylish.

The Influence of Movie Jackets on Fashion

The impact of movie jackets on fashion cannot be overstated. Whether they become instant fashion trends or gradually gain cult status, these pieces often make their way into everyday wardrobes. This trend can be seen with classics like leather biker jackets, which gained mainstream popularity thanks to films like Easy Rider and Grease. The rebellious spirit captured by these films resonated with audiences, and the jackets became symbols of counterculture and youthful defiance.
